Why does it feel like you're starting over every Monday? You wake up with intention, you feel a spark, you tell yourself this is the week, and for a moment it is. And then something happens. Life shows up, energy drops, old patterns creep back in, and before you know it, you're right back where you started again. Here's the truth most people don't realize. You're not failing because you lack motivation, you're failing because you're relying on it. Motivation is a feeling. A feeling comes and goes. So if your entire life is built on something that disappears, then of course it'll feel like you're starting over every single week. Motivation says, I'll move when I feel ready, but a system says I move whether I feel ready or not. That's the difference. One depends on emotion, the other creates momentum. Let's bring this down to real life. Joe wakes up Monday morning and says, I'm gonna eat better this week. That's motivation. By Wednesday, he's tired, work was stressful, something unexpected happened, and now he's ordering the same food, falling into the same patterns, telling himself he'll try again next week. That's not a discipline problem, that's a systems problem. Because a system doesn't ask, do I feel like it today? A system answers, what happens when I don't feel like it? You don't need to become a more motivated person, you need to become a more supported person. You need something in your life that catches you when you fall, guides you when you're unsure, and carries you forward when your energy drops. Because right now, every Monday, you're trying to restart your life instead of continuing it. So here's your step for today. Don't try to fix your whole life. Just identify one thing you keep starting over. And ask yourself this question: what would make this automatic instead of optional? Not exciting, not inspiring, automatic. Because the moment something becomes automatic, you stop starting over. This is where the shift begins. Not in intensity, not in motivation, but in structure.
